Come join us in delivering better outcomes for our clients around the world! What is IBOR Services - responsible for? The team is responsible for a variety of investment accounting functions such as recording cash-related transactions in the SimCorp Dimension application, reconciling cash and security positions to various custodian records, and ensuring the portfolios are in good order for Portfolio Managers. What is the Senior Analyst - IBOR – in the IBOR responsible for? The Senior Analyst is responsible for reviewing all IBOR Services Operations through process and data analysis in order to ensure that appropriate internal controls are in place. This may include reconciling, analysis, and/or reporting. To resolve non-routine problems in a timely manner in order to minimize financial and operational risk exposure. To support the IBOR Services team’s initiatives, providing leadership and expertise in all key functions related to IBOR Services. May assist with the planning and administration of the daily work assigned to staff in order to ensure it is completed in accordance with departmental guidelines.
